Concrete fo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or sinking concrete slabs. The process typically includes assessing the current state of the foundation, identifying areas of settlement or movement, and then employing specialized techniques to restore the slab to a level position. These services often utilize methods such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ection, which lift and support the concrete without extensive demolition or replacement. The goal is to improve the structural integrity of the property and prevent further issues related to shifting or settling.
This service addresses common problems associated with uneven concrete surfaces, such as cracked or cracked-looking slabs, uneven flooring inside the property, and drainage issues caused by misaligned slabs. Over time, soil movement, moisture fluctuations, and natural settling can cause concrete foundations to shift, leading to safety hazards and potential damage to the property’s structure. Concrete foundation leveling helps mitigate these issues by restoring the proper alignment of the slab, which can also improve the functionality of walkways, driveways, patios, and garage floors.

Cost Range - Concrete foundation leveling services typically cost between $1,000 and $3,500, depending on the extent of the work. For example, minor adjustments may be closer to $1,000, while extensive repairs can approach $3,500 or more.
Factors Affecting Cost - The total price varies based on foundation size, soil conditions, and the severity of settlement. Larger or more complex projects generally increase the overall cost.
Typical Pricing Models - Many service providers charge a flat fee for standard leveling jobs, with prices often falling within the $1,500 to $2,500 range. Additional costs may apply for extensive underpinning or reinforcement.
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, site preparation, or repairs to surrounding structures can add to the base price. It’s advisable to get detailed estimates from local pros for accurate budgeting.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ation leveling? Concrete foundation leveling involves adjusting and stabilizing a sunken or uneven foundation to ensure a level and secure structure.
Why might a foundation need leveling? Foundations may require leveling due to soil settlement, moisture issues, or shifting ground over time.
How do professionals perform foundation leveling? Local service providers typically use techniques like mudjacking or polyurethane foam injections to lift and stabilize foundations.
Are foundation leveling services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ally suitable for most concrete slab foundations, but a professional assessment is recommended.
What are the signs that a foundation needs leveling?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ick or do not close properly.
